Newcastle, Oklahoma is located in the northernmost corner of McClain County, with a portion of the city in Grady County. At the time when it was formed in the late 1800s, it was part of the Chickasaw Indian Territory. Its first post office was established in 1894. Although its post office moved in 1905 and agin in 1920, each of these locations are within the current city limits.
